Nambatac stars as Rain or Shine breaks through, spoils Ginebra’s 1000th win bid

The Rain or Shine Elasto Painters finally scored a win in the 2019 PBA Commissioner’s Cup, blasting defending champions Barangay Ginebra San Miguel, 104-81, Friday night at the SMART Araneta Coliseum.

Sophomore guard Rey Nambatac exploded for a career-high 30 points — spiked by seven three-pointers — on top of two rebounds and an assist to lead the Elasto Painters, who have improved to 1-2 following the blowout victory.

Not to be outdone is import Denzel Bowles as he filled the stat sheet with 25 points, 17 rebounds, six assists, two blocks, and two steals to score a win over his former coach Tim Cone, whom he played for before with Purefoods.

Bowles’ free throws with less than three minutes left to play gave Rain or Shine its biggest lead of the game, 102-77.

“I told them everybody becomes better when you play against Ginebra. First of all, they’re the defending champions this conference and what better way to get out of a slump is to try to beat Ginebra,” said Rain or Shine head coach Caloy Garcia.

Rookie Javee Mocon produced 11 points, six assists, five rebounds, and two steals in the triumph.

The Elasto Painters shot 48.1 percent from the field, including an 11-of-34 clip from beyond the arc. It was a marked improvement as they only shot 38 percent in their two losses, including a measly 21 percent from three.

“I felt that we played good in the first two games except that we couldn’t hit our outside shots. I told them if you wanna go and win lots of games in this league, we have to be consistent in hitting outside shots,” Garcia said.

Justin Brownlee led the Gin Kings with 30 points and 17 rebounds in the loss that dragged them down to 2-2.

Japeth Aguilar chimed in 17 markers on 8-of-10 shooting, with four rebounds. Scottie Thompson only scored four points on 10 attempts, but he still almost registered a double-double as he collected 10 assists and nine caroms.

Rain or Shine will next face Phoenix Pulse Fuel Masters this Sunday, June 9, at Ynares Center in Antipolo City. The Gin Kings, meanwhile, will look to recover when they take on TNT KaTropa on June 12, Wednesday, still at the Big Dome.

The Scores:

Rain or Shine 104 – Nambatac 30, Bowles 25, Mocon 11, Belga 9, Yap 8, Norwood 5, Daquioag 5, Borboran 4, Alejandro 4, Torres 3, Ponferada 0, Rosales 0, Onwubere 0.

Ginebra 81 – Brownlee 30, Aguilar 17, Tenorio 8, Mercado 5, Mariano 4, Thompson 4, Slaughter 4, Ferrer 3, Teodoro 3, Devance 2, Caperal 1, Cruz 0.

Quarterscores: 26-25, 54-45, 75-66, 104-81
